• ADADADADAD

    ajax中的data怎么获取所有数据类型[ 编程知识 ]

    编程知识 时间:2024-12-18 16:49:49

    作者:文/会员上传

    简介:

    在使用ajax时,我们经常需要通过data属性来传递数据。data属性可以是不同的数据类型,如字符串、对象、数组等。本文将介绍在ajax中如何获取不同数据类型的data,并提供示例来加深

    以下为本文的正文内容,内容仅供参考!本站为公益性网站,复制本文以及下载DOC文档全部免费。

    在使用ajax时,我们经常需要通过data属性来传递数据。data属性可以是不同的数据类型,如字符串、对象、数组等。本文将介绍在ajax中如何获取不同数据类型的data,并提供示例来加深理解。首先,我们来看一个简单的字符串类型的data。假设我们需要向服务器发送一个请求并传递一个用户名,则data属性可以这样设置:
    $.ajax({url: "example.com",method: "POST",data: "username=JohnDoe",success: function(response) {// 处理服务器返回的数据}});
    在这个例子中,data属性为字符串类型,值为"username=JohnDoe"。当服务器接收到这个请求时,可以通过相应的方法来解析出用户名这个值。这种情况下,我们可以直接从data属性中获取到字符串。接下来,我们来看一个对象类型的data。假设我们需要发送一个包含多个参数的请求,我们可以将这些参数存储在一个对象中,并将该对象作为data属性的值:
    $.ajax({url: "example.com",method: "POST",data: {username: "JohnDoe",age: 25},success: function(response) {// 处理服务器返回的数据}});
    在这个例子中,data属性的值为一个包含两个属性的对象。服务器可以通过解析这个对象来获取到用户名和年龄这两个值。当我们需要传递多个参数时,使用对象作为data属性的值会更加方便和清晰。此外,我们也可以使用数组作为data属性的值。假设我们需要传递一组数值给服务器,我们可以将这些数值存储在一个数组中,并将该数组作为data属性的值:
    $.ajax({url: "example.com",method: "POST",data: [1, 2, 3, 4, 5],success: function(response) {// 处理服务器返回的数据}});
    在这个例子中,data属性的值为一个包含5个数值的数组。服务器可以通过解析这个数组来获取到这组数值。使用数组作为data属性的值在一些特定的场景中非常有用。除了字符串、对象和数组类型的data,我们还可以传递其他类型的数据,如布尔值、数字等。无论我们传递的是什么类型的数据,服务器都可以通过相应的方法来获取到这些数据。综上所述,我们可以通过data属性来传递不同类型的数据给服务器。不论是字符串、对象、数组,甚至其他数据类型,都可以通过相应的方法来解析和获取。在使用ajax时,我们要根据实际需求选择最适合的数据类型,并注意服务器端如何解析这些数据。通过以上的示例和解释,我们希望读者能够充分理解如何在ajax中获取不同数据类型的data,以便更好地应用于实际开发中。
    ajax中的data怎么获取所有数据类型.docx

    将本文的Word文档下载到电脑

    推荐度:

    下载